Transaction 8b9873f490ff045d1179c3324c236aab790b1219262fe4399011167677f00382
1 Input
1 Output
-
8b9873f490ff045d1179c3324c236aab790b1219262fe4399011167677f00382:0
- value
- 528764
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 33c5158022789b62028e2a4e6709f7c307426772 OP_EQUAL
- address
- 36QkUxnGJXVCQJVJ2nYNc4CqBQihn8nvz3